  • Cast in Bronze and Chiseled Out of Stone: The Story of the Caribbean as Told by its Statues

    Dr. Phillips Center for the Performing Arts Downtown

    UCF Pegasus Professor Luis Martínez-Fernández delivers a dynamic, informative and entertaining audiovisual presentation that offers a flash course in Caribbean history as told by the region’s statues. While inanimate objects, statues have lives of their own and some actually perish as the result of neglect, revolution or resistance.
